Spain celebrated a thrilling victory over France in the UEFA Nations League semifinals. Lamine Yamal scored twice, leading Spain to a 5-4 win. The match took place in Stuttgart and set up a final against Portugal.
Yamal, a 17-year-old Barcelona forward, played a key role. He helped Spain take leads of 4-0 and 5-1 during the game. France made a late comeback, scoring three times in the last 11 minutes.
Despite their efforts, Spain held on for the win. They will face Portugal in Munich on Sunday. Meanwhile, France will play Germany for third place in Stuttgart.
Spain started strong with goals from Nico Williams and Mikel Merino. Yamal earned a penalty after being fouled by Adrien Rabiot. He calmly converted it, sending goalkeeper Mike Maignan the wrong way.
Pedri then made it 4-0 with a clinical finish from Williams' pass. Kylian Mbappe pulled one back for France with a penalty after Pedro Porro's foul.
Yamal scored his second goal to make it 5-1 with a low strike. However, France's Rayan Cherki sparked their revival on his debut. He volleyed home from 20 yards out after receiving Mbappe's pass.
Dani Vivian accidentally scored an own goal six minutes before time. In injury time, Randal Kolo Muani headed in Cherki’s cross to make it 5-4. Despite their late surge, France could not equalize.
